According to Enyimba’s Friday letter sent by Felix Anyansi Agwu and published by the Guardian, “We write to officially notify you of the extremely difficult situations currently encountered by Enyimba FC for the CAF Confederation Cup playoff fixture against Al-Ittihad. Anyansi further said: “Efforts by the club’s management and the Nigerian Embassy in Tunisia to get a special waiver for the team have not yielded results, even in spite of the team providing proof of negative COVID-19 test results. The only other alternative given was to observe a 7-day quarantine upon arrival in Tunisia but with the game just two days away, that option becomes completely unrealistic.
The club proceeded to secure Libyan visas, only to be notified a few days ago that the game would be played in Tunisia. The club had to race against time to obtain Tunisian visas, only to be faced with this ugly situation, he wrote.
